Microsoft Copilot, an AI-powered assistant integrated into Windows 11 and various Microsoft applications, is poised to revolutionize the role of cybersecurity advisors.

Let’s dive into how cybersecurity professionals can leverage Microsoft Copilot to enhance their advisory capabilities and bolster security practices.

Understanding Microsoft Copilot

Microsoft Copilot is an AI assistant designed to assist users with various tasks, including finding information, creating content, and learning new skills. Integrated seamlessly into Windows 11 and Microsoft applications such as Word, Excel, PowerPoint, and …
